It mounts via screw or snap-on onto a 35 mm DIN rail per DIN EN 60715, and the S0 footprint (102 mm height, 45 mm width, 144 mm depth) fits standard panel layouts where space is allocated for a compact contactor block. The magnet coil termination uses spring-type terminals, which speeds wiring compared to screw clamps — useful on lines where changeover time matters. The coil is rated for 24 VDC nominal; the auxiliary contact ratings vary by voltage, with 6 A at 24 V rated value and 2 A at 48 V or 60 V, so confirm the load on the aux circuit matches the voltage-specific curve.
Switching frequency limits define how often this contactor can cycle without overheating. At AC-1 (resistive load) it handles up to 1 000 operations per hour; at AC-3 (motor starting) and AC-3e (enhanced motor) the limit is 750 per hour. For AC-4 (inching/plugging duty) it drops to 250 per hour — a hard constraint for applications like reversing conveyors or jogging cranes. Solid or stranded wire from 1 to 10 mm² is accepted on the main terminals, and the auxiliary circuit accepts 2x (0.5 to 2.5 mm²) — standard for control wiring. The contactor has no built-in auxiliary switch, so if you need a mirror contact or early-make/early-break, you'll add a separate auxiliary contact block.
